Pizza Seasoning Garlic Bread

Garlic bread made at home should never need a store-bought seasoning sachet. This version uses Herby Spice Blend — basil, oregano, miriyalu, and garlic already ground together — mixed straight into softened butter for a coating that is fragrant, lightly spiced, and ready in minutes. Toast it on a tawa until the edges crisp and the butter melts into the bread, and you will not miss the packet version at all.

Prep: 5 min  |  Cook: 5 min  |  Serves: 2  |  Difficulty: Easy

Ingredients

  • 2 tsp  Herby Spice Blend (Kitchen Koundinyasa)
  • 4 slices  bread (thick white or whole wheat)
  • 2 tbsp  butter, softened at room temperature
  • 1 tsp  olive oil or any neutral oil
  • to taste  salt

Method

  1. In a small bowl, mix the softened butter with the Herby Spice Blend and a small pinch of salt. Stir until the blend is evenly worked through the butter — it should look speckled green and smell immediately of basil and oregano.
  2. Spread the herby butter generously on one side of each bread slice, covering all the way to the edges so the corners do not stay dry.
  3. Heat a tawa on medium flame. Add the oil and let it warm for a few seconds.
  4. Place the bread slices butter-side down on the tawa. Press gently with a spatula so the butter makes full contact with the surface.
  5. Toast for 2 to 3 minutes until the underside turns golden and the edges begin to colour. You will smell the basil and pepper toasting — that is the moment to take them off.
  6. Slide off the tawa immediately and serve hot. The butter will have soaked into the bread and the edges should be just crisp. Serve as a snack on its own or alongside a bowl of soup or pasta.
